Manchester City dominated the FA Cup clash with an emphatic 4-1 win over Southampton. The game saw early success for Manchester City as Raheem Sterling opened the scoring in the 12th minute, followed by a bizarre own goal from Aymeric Laporte just before half-time that brought the score to 2-0. Kevin De Bruyne then converted a penalty and added another goal for Foden and Mahrez later on, cementing Manchester City's victory. Southampton managed only one goal late in the match.
